MAGELSSEN v. ATWELL

No. 11599.

451 P.2d 103 (1969)

William MAGELSSEN, Plaintiff and Appellant, v. W.G. ATWELL et al., Defendants and Respondents.

Supreme Court of Montana.

Decided March 5, 1969.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Berger, Anderson & Sinclair, James J. Sinclair (argued), Billings, for appellant.

William F. Meisburger, County Atty. (argued), Forsyth, for respondents.


BONNER, Justice.

Plaintiff, William Magelssen, brought this action to quiet title to Section 15, Township 10 North, Range 35 East, M.P.M., Rosebud County, Montana. The cause was tried before the Honorable Alfred B. Coate sitting without a jury, and judgment was entered against the plaintiff. The plaintiff now appeals alleging three issues for review: (1) that the evidence does not support the findings of fact, conclusions of law and judgment entered by the court;...
